Today was not only the first day of Fall for 2013 but it was also time for the Brooklyn Autumn Guitar Show and it was a fun day of exploring the Brooklyn Bowl once more to see what the vendors and builders had up their sleeves for this seasons show. Check out the awesome poster for the event and then keep on scrolling to enjoy our images and some thoughts about the show.
As I mentioned in my broadcast show post a couple of weeks ago, this time around the show would feature a number of new vendors along with the folks that have established a little more tenure at this particular space. Once again I was joined by my stalwart companion in Convention adventuring, the great Skeleton Pete Parrella, and here are the findings that I observed.
